Miscreants wearing masks set a police van on fire in Gopalganj on Wednesday morning, leaving five police personnel injured. The incident occurred around 9:00 am in the Khatiaghar area of Durgapur Union under Sadar Upazila. According to police and local sources, tension had been running high in the district following the announcement that central leaders of the National Citizen Party (NCP) would visit Gopalganj as part of their July march. On Wednesday morning, while on routine patrol, a police van was passing through the Khatiaghar area when around 40 to 50 masked individuals suddenly attacked it and set it ablaze. Five police members inside the van sustained injuries.The attackers also attempted to seize the van. Upon receiving an alert, another nearby police patrol team rushed to the scene, prompting the assailants to flee.

The injured police members were rescued and taken to hospital for treatment. A local woman, who wished to remain anonymous, said, “They were all wearing masks. Suddenly, they set fire to the police vehicle. When we tried to get closer, they warned us to stay away.” Additional Superintendent of Police Ruhul Amin said, “Police have inspected the scene. So far, no one has been arrested in connection with the incident. We are making every effort to bring the perpetrators to justice as soon as possible.”
